

Richard Louv
Richard Louv is a journalist and author of nine books, including ,, and . His books have been translated into 13 languages and published in 17 countries, and helped launch an international movement to connect children and their families to nature. Louv is co-founder and Chairman Emeritus of the , an organization helping build the international movement to connect people and communities to the natural world.
